Transaction fcd97d9cce60e2f8cb06dfbd1d9ae0f480a43d32794aa97a5bf62663f3e45d68

block
1857facf9baa18674f193606edae060091263e289a2ac3df0a774fad4cfdcfbe

1 Input

24 Outputs